FOOD SOURCING &
BUDGET ANALYSIS
 

Visualization techniques bring your operations data to life through FFEN’s Food Sourcing Analysis (FSA) reports. The FSA uses your ordering history to generate a series of easy-to-read infographics that let you directly compare costs to shopper outcome metrics for better decision-making
and resource allocation.

Food Shelf Layout Consultation

Get the most from your space and equipment through a collaborative layout design process, focused on shopper experience and placing fresh foods first. We also provide funding or leverage external grant opportunities for material improvements like
coolers, freezers,
and shelving.

Navigating the Hunger
Relief System

Gain insights on how to strategically engage the robust hunger relief network to best leverage local, regional and statewide resources for your community in order to provide your shoppers with more high-quality food options and leading practices for dignified and consistent access.

FFEN Impact Areas

Increase Food Access:
We support food shelves to adopt practices that encourage increased visit frequency to the food shelf and expanded ways to welcome community members experiencing food insecurity to see the food shelf as a critical resource.

Increase Fresh Food:
We support food shelves to increase their fresh food offerings with priority placed on offering fresh food first and predictably for their shoppers.

Improve Shopper Experience:
We support food shelves to improve their shopper experience with a focus on customer service and decreasing barriers to access food.

Improve Organizational Health:
We support food shelves move towards strengthened sustainability by applying a business lens to organizational operations including budgeting, infrastructure and community fundraising.
